    What we know about moving in Carson

    Who's moving here

    Most of our Carson work ties to the city's flat tract housing and its mix of homes next to heavy industry. There's a steady flow of single-family homeowners in the 1960s and 1970s master-planned tracts, Carriage Crest, Del Amo, Dominguez, and the central Carson neighborhoods around Carson Street and Avalon Boulevard. Townhome and condo owners come through too, especially in HOA communities like Scottsdale off Avalon, where shared parking and association rules set part of the schedule. Apartment residents near Cal State Dominguez Hills move on the academic calendar, with controlled-access buildings and tight on-site parking. Office and commercial work comes from general office, retail, and warehouse-adjacent tenants along Carson Street, Del Amo Boulevard, Avalon Boulevard, and the Alameda Street logistics corridor. We handle Carson as part of our Los Angeles moving services, running it out of North Hollywood like the rest of the South Bay. The patterns repeat: a family trading an older Del Amo house for a newer tract, or a household heading from a Carson apartment to Torrance, Long Beach, or Gardena. We do a lot of those.

    How the streets shape a move

    Carson is flat, so the constraints here are man-made, not hillside. The residential tracts, Scottsdale, Carriage Crest, Del Amo, and the central Carson blocks, sit on standard flat streets with normal driveways and curbs, so staging a truck is usually simple. What tightens the day is everything around them. The Alameda Street corridor, the Del Amo Boulevard and Avalon Boulevard retail stretches, and the refinery-adjacent frontage on the north and east sides all carry steady warehouse and port truck traffic, so we time the drive legs around the freight flow. The HOA townhome communities like Scottsdale run narrow internal drive aisles with guest-only parking and shared lots, so a long carry from a staged spot is routine. Near Cal State Dominguez Hills, the apartment complexes have controlled-access entries and limited parking, so we plan a carry from wherever management lets a truck sit. Out on the industrial blocks, a 26-foot truck fits the wide streets fine but shares them with container and delivery trucks. The truck and the parking plan change from a quiet tract street to a townhome drive aisle to a busy commercial corridor.

    Permits and street rules

    Permits and street rules

    On most Carson blocks, parking the truck at the curb on a flat residential street is straightforward. But along Carson Street, Avalon Boulevard, or Del Amo Boulevard, on busy retail frontage, or where the truck needs to sit for hours, a staging plan matters more than a curb spot. The City of Carson Public Works Department, at 701 E. Carson Street, reviews and permits work within the public right-of-way, and you can reach them at (310) 952-1795 to ask what applies to a moving truck on your block. An encroachment permit is required any time work happens in the public right-of-way, so if your job needs anything tied to it, call ahead. Whether Carson issues a dedicated moving-truck or temporary no-parking curb reservation, as opposed to a general encroachment permit, is worth confirming with the city directly, since it isn't clearly published. Pulling any permit and posting it is your job, not ours, but we'll tell you exactly where we need the truck to sit so you can request the right spot. Oversize truck movement on the state routes around Carson, the I-405, I-110, I-710, and SR-91, is handled by Caltrans, separate from a city permit.

    Mid-century homes and 1970s tracts

    Mid-century homes and 1970s tracts

    Carson's housing is mostly flat tract stock, and the carry changes by era. The older Del Amo and Dominguez blocks hold mid-century homes from the 1940s through the 1960s, with narrower doorways, older staircases, and the occasional built-in cabinet or hutch. The big wave of master-planned tracts, Scottsdale, Carriage Crest, and the central Carson neighborhoods, went up in the 1960s and 1970s after the city incorporated in 1968, with standard single-story and two-story layouts on modest lots. Some newer gated tracts have filled in since, running to larger two-story homes with wider rooms but tighter interior staircases. In the older homes, a wide sofa or sectional sometimes takes a careful angle, and other times we take a door off the hinges or break down a bed frame to get it clear. A mattress doesn't come apart, so we carry it flat and ease a box spring through on the diagonal. We pad the doorframes and any built-in millwork on the way out, lay floor runners on the floors, and wrap furniture in moving blankets and bubble wrap. We don't pre-measure on a site visit, so it helps to describe the doorway and stairwell situation in Carson ahead of time, along with anything heavy or awkward, when you ask for the quote.

    Best days and times

    Best days and times

    Carson sits inside a box of freeways, so timing keys off all four. I-405, the San Diego Freeway, cuts east-west through the middle; I-110, the Harbor Freeway, runs the western edge; I-710, the Long Beach Freeway, runs part of the eastern edge; and SR-91, the Artesia Freeway, crosses the north. The 110 and 710 are major port-freight routes, so warehouse and container truck traffic is heaviest on weekday mornings and around the Alameda Street corridor. A mid-morning start, after the early commuter and freight crush clears, usually keeps the drive between your two locations short and the hourly clock honest. Event days at Dignity Health Sports Park off Avalon Boulevard and Victoria Street, Galaxy soccer matches and concerts, push local traffic and parking near the Cal State Dominguez Hills campus, so it's worth checking the stadium schedule for a nearby move. Weekdays are quieter along the Carson Street and Avalon Boulevard retail corridors, and in the apartment and townhome communities the manager and HOA coordination is easier midweek than on a packed Saturday. Moves in Carson peak in summer, June through August, with the school calendar and lease turnover, plus a late-summer surge tied to Cal State Dominguez Hills move-in, so those dates fill faster. We'll talk timing through in your written quote.
